Transaction 50a63b7732d536f37d0f3e0a4de473fcdd1d329ff846e6032d42ee34882fa658
1 Input
2 Outputs
- 50a63b7732d536f37d0f3e0a4de473fcdd1d329ff846e6032d42ee34882fa658:0
- 50a63b7732d536f37d0f3e0a4de473fcdd1d329ff846e6032d42ee34882fa658:1
value 19651
address 1EepNAXiwW99vVBx6X1n1M3dC2zWpo9NGx
value 2650649
address 1MEMuJnPoQ3JznB97tmbxhkFKyz9GKbe1R